Analog Synthesizers
Analog synthesizers are known for their warm, rich sound and versatility. These machines use analog circuits to generate sound, resulting in a distinct tone that many producers covet. Analog synthesizers often feature multiple parameters, such as filters, amplitude, and pitch, allowing for intricate sound-shaping capabilities. They’re ideal for creating unique textures and tones, and are particularly well-suited for genres like house, techno, and synthwave.
- Vintage warmth: Analog synthesizers produce a warm, rich sound that’s difficult to replicate with digital instruments.
- Hands-on control: Analog synthesizers often feature a robust, hands-on interface, allowing producers to tweak parameters in real-time.
- Multiple parameters: Analog synthesizers frequently include multiple parameters, such as filters, amplitude, and pitch, giving producers a wide range of sound-shaping options.
- Noise generators: Analog synthesizers often feature noise generators, allowing producers to create a wide range of textures and sounds.

Synthesizers designed for live performance are typically built with portability and ease of use in mind. They often feature rugged constructions, compact designs, and intuitive controls that allow artists to switch between sounds and patches on the fly. These synths are perfect for musicians who need to take their music on the road or perform in non-traditional settings.
On the other hand, studio synthesizers are typically designed to provide the highest level of sound quality and flexibility. They often feature advanced editing capabilities, a wide range of built-in effects, and the ability to work seamlessly with other studio equipment. These synths are ideal for producers who need to craft complex sounds and textures in the comfort of their own studio.

Achieving Unique Timbres using Various Synthesis Techniques
Achieving unique timbres using various synthesis techniques involves understanding the principles of sound synthesis and the different techniques that can be used to create complex and interesting sounds. Here are some key techniques for creating unique timbres:
- Frequency Modulation (FM): FM involves modulating the frequency of one oscillator with the output of another oscillator. This creates a range of new timbres that are not possible with traditional synthesis methods. Example: In the synthesizer, FM can be achieved by routing the output of an oscillator to the frequency input of another oscillator.
- Amplitude Modulation (AM): AM involves modulating the amplitude of an oscillator with an external source, such as an envelope generator or an LFO. This creates a range of new timbres that are not possible with traditional synthesis methods. Example: In the synthesizer, AM can be achieved by routing the output of an envelope generator or LFO to the amplitude input of an oscillator.
- Ring Modulation: Ring modulation involves multiplying the output of one oscillator with the output of another oscillator. This creates a range of new timbres that are not possible with traditional synthesis methods. - The Korg MS-20 is a legendary semi-modular analog synthesizer designed to be a powerful tool for sound design and experimentation. Its unique design allows users to patch together custom sounds, making it a favorite among electronic music producers and musicians who require a high level of creative control.

What is the difference between analog and digital synthesizers?
Analog synthesizers use physical components to generate sound, whereas digital synthesizers use software algorithms to produce sound. Analog synthesizers often have a warmer, more organic sound, while digital synthesizers can offer more versatility and precision.
